The New Old School of Music,LLC was created with the following goals in mind:
1.Student-centered and positive environment, focused on catering to the social, emotional, and educational needs of each student
2.Helping each student build self-confidence
3.Encourage students to express their feelings through music
4.Fun activity that could be shared with friends, family, community
